How they compare

Philippines currently reports 461.73 million NFL, current US$ against 425.79 million NFL, current US$ in Peru, a difference of 35.94 million NFL, current US$.

That makes Philippines's figure about 1.1 times Peru's.

The two have swapped places 14 times across 55 shared years of data; in 1970 it was Philippines ahead.

Globally, Peru ranks 13th and Philippines ranks 11th of 122 countries.

Bilateral debt includes loans from governments and their agencies (including central banks), loans from autonomous bodies, and direct loans from official export credit agencies. Net flows (or net lending or net disbursements) received by the borrower during the year are disbursements minus principal repayments. Data are in current U.S. dollars.
